    Alexander Shunnarah is a personal injury lawyer from Alabama, United States. He is the founder, president, and CEO of Alexander Shunnarah Injury Lawyers, which operates in Alabama, Tennessee, Arkansas, Florida, Mississippi, Louisiana, Texas, Wisconsin, Massachusetts, New Hampshire, New York, and Georgia.
